pascal的迴圈問題

2023-02-28 09:55:22 字數 531 閱讀 1256

1樓:幽幽深紫

for i=1 to n(限定的數的分母) do接下來說思路吧。。

總之分母是i,分子就是i-1,除一除就行了。

然後把每次除得的商累加到一個變數中去。

能明白吧?

2樓:

varn,i : longint;

ans : double;

begin

read(n);

ans:=1;

for i:=2 to n do ans:=ans+(i-1)/i;

writeln(ans:0:8);

end.

3樓:逸之朦朧

var n,i:longint;

sum:real;

begin

readln(n);

sum:=0;

for i:=1 to n do

sum:=sum+1/i;

writeln(sum);

end.

Pascal問題 矩陣乘法,Pascal 矩陣乘法的完整過程?

vara,b,c,i,j,k longint x,y,f array 0.2000,0.2000 of longint begin read a read b read c for i 1 to a do for j 1 to b do read x i,j for i 1 to b do for ...

Pascal的if語句問題

1.要確認a能不能被b整除,只要a除b的餘數 0,那麼他就能被b整除。否則就輸出a,除號,b,等號,商 用整除函式div 再用a b 商。程式 var a,b integer beginreadln a,b if a mod b 0 then write a,b,a div b elsewrite ...

pascal郵票問題

你最後一步的prin寫錯了!應該這樣寫 var n,m,i,mm integer a array 1.100 of integer money array 0.10000 of boolean procedure print var max,i,j integer begin max 0 區域性變數...